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ities

Although small, Maesteg (Ewenny Road) train station is equipped to meet the needs of travelers. Featuring accessible ticket machines, individuals can easily collect tickets purchased online. While a ticket office is absent, the card-only machines ensure hassle-free transactions. There's also an induction loop for those who require it. Although the station does not offer many conveniences, passengers have access to seating areas to relax before their journey.

Accessibility is partial at Maesteg (Ewenny Road). While there is step-free access via a steep ramp, it lacks handrails, categorizing the station as B1 for accessibility. Customer support is primarily available through the helpline, ensuring assistance is just a call away.

Essentially, the station provides the basics, with no facilities for wa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shments. Passengers should plan accordingly, especially if traveling with young children or requiring particular amenities.

Transport Links

Maesteg (Ewenny Road) station offers a rail replacement bus service for your convenience, particularly important during times of disruption or planned closures. The designated bus stop is conveniently located at the station entrance on Oakwood Drive. Unfortunately, there are no bicycle hire facilities or dedicated taxi services at the station, so consider making arrangements in advance if these are required.

Features and Facilities at Dingle Road

At first glance, Dingle Road station might seem understated, but it houses essential features to aid your travel needs. Despite the absence of a ticket office, there are ticket machines available to collect tickets bought online, providing a seamless transaction experience. These machines are accommodating for all, with accessibility features ensuring that everyone can access train services. It's important to note that the machine only accepts card payments, so plan accordingly.

The station is equipped with helpful facilities such as induction loops and customer help points, ensuring that passengers can get the assistance they need. While it lacks amenities like public Wi-Fi, on-site refreshment facilities, and accessible bathrooms, the station offers comfortable seating areas, and CCTV is installed for safety and assurance.

Getting Around: Transport Links and Accessibility

Travelers will appreciate the rail replacement services, with the bus stop conveniently located on Windsor Road. Although Dingle Road station does not offer direct car hire or taxi stands, its location is well integrated into local transport networks. Those requiring step-free access can rest easy knowing that ramps with shallow gradients are available, rated as Category B1 access, making it more accommodating for wheelchair users and those with heavy luggage.
